Me and @illusivelf moved at Thessaloniki city 6 months ago and we are having so much fun living here!

Thessaloniki is the 2nd biggest city in Greece, full of beautiful old buildings, uderground alleys and of course a ton of street food shops.

Moving at a bigger city and spending that much time outside definitely impacted our daily routine and despite the fact that we are having the time of our lives, some bad habits "knocked our door" like smoking and a bad nutrition.

We decided to tackle both these problems at the same time so we are limiting smoking and adding a ton more green on our table. Actually, we visited the flea market today and bought all these goodies.

Food is the fuel of our bodies so eating well will positively impact both our physical and mental health as well as help us in reducing/cutting off smoking too.

We decided to take things one step further so we wrote down a list of our favourite "healthy" foods and scheduled our meals for the next 4 days!

Having bought all these vegetables "forces" us to eat them. Who likes to throw food away?!? I bet it's not gonna be that hard judging from how tasty all these veggies look like!

Today was the first day we sticked to our "schedule" and we cooked a really delicious potato-salad with peppers, carrot, onion, mayonesse and spicies accompanied with lettuce with olive oil, garlic and lemon!

We are still full from this epic meal and we will cook fried eggplants and zuccini for dinner accompanied with a "Greek Salad". Haven't eaten fried vegetables for a while now and I can't wait hehehe!
